
在Excel中使用横线分隔年月日的方法有多种,包括使用日期格式设置、文本函数和自定义格式。这些方法各有优缺点,具体应用时需要根据实际需求来选择。以下将详细介绍几种常用的方法,并对其中一种进行详细描述。
一、日期格式设置
Excel内置了多种日期格式,可以通过设置单元格格式来实现年月日之间用横线分隔的效果。具体步骤如下:
- 选中需要设置的单元格或区域。
- 右键点击,选择“设置单元格格式”。
- 在弹出的对话框中,选择“数字”选项卡。
- 点击“日期”,然后选择一种带有横线分隔的日期格式,例如“YYYY-MM-DD”。
- 点击“确定”保存设置。
这种方法的优点是简单快捷,无需使用任何函数或公式,适合大多数场景。
二、自定义格式
如果内置的日期格式无法满足需求,可以使用自定义格式来实现更灵活的设置。具体步骤如下:
- 选中需要设置的单元格或区域。
- 右键点击,选择“设置单元格格式”。
- 在弹出的对话框中,选择“数字”选项卡。
- 点击“自定义”。
- 在“类型”框中输入自定义格式代码,例如“YYYY-MM-DD”。
- 点击“确定”保存设置。
自定义格式可以更精确地控制日期显示格式,适合需要特殊格式的场景。
三、TEXT函数
如果需要在公式中动态生成带有横线分隔的日期,可以使用TEXT函数。具体公式如下:
=TEXT(A1, "YYYY-MM-DD")
其中,A1是包含日期的单元格。这个方法的优点是可以在公式中灵活使用,适合需要动态生成日期格式的场景。
四、组合文本函数
如果日期是分开存储在不同的单元格中,可以使用文本函数组合成带有横线分隔的格式。具体公式如下:
=A1 & "-" & B1 & "-" & C1
其中,A1、B1和C1分别包含年、月、日。这个方法的优点是适合处理非标准日期格式的数据。
五、使用Excel的Power Query功能
对于更复杂的数据处理需求,可以使用Excel的Power Query功能来实现日期格式的转换。具体步骤如下:
- 打开Excel,点击“数据”选项卡。
- 选择“从表/范围”,导入数据。
- 在Power Query编辑器中,选择需要转换的日期列。
- 右键点击,选择“更改类型”,然后选择“使用区域设置”。
- 在弹出的对话框中,选择“日期”类型,并设置合适的格式。
- 点击“确定”,然后关闭并加载数据。
这种方法适合处理大规模数据和需要复杂转换的场景。
六、宏与VBA
对于需要自动化处理的场景,可以使用VBA编写宏来实现日期格式的转换。以下是一个简单的VBA示例:
Sub FormatDate()
Dim rng As Range
Set rng = Selection
For Each cell In rng
cell.Value = Format(cell.Value, "YYYY-MM-DD")
Next cell
End Sub
这个宏可以将选中的单元格中的日期格式转换为“YYYY-MM-DD”格式。适合需要批量处理日期格式的场景。
总结
在Excel中使用横线分隔年月日的方法有很多,选择合适的方法可以提高工作效率。日期格式设置和自定义格式是最简单快捷的方法,适合大多数场景;TEXT函数和组合文本函数适合需要动态生成格式的场景;Power Query和VBA宏则适合处理复杂数据和自动化需求。根据实际情况选择合适的方法,可以大大提升Excel的使用效率。
相关问答FAQs:
1. 如何在Excel中的年月日之间添加横线?
在Excel中,您可以使用以下步骤在年月日之间添加横线:
- 首先,确保您的日期格式是正确的。选择包含日期的单元格,然后转到“开始”选项卡,在“数字”组下选择合适的日期格式。
- 接下来,选中包含日期的单元格,然后点击“开始”选项卡上的“边框”按钮。
- 在弹出的边框格式对话框中,选择“底部边框”选项,然后选择您想要的线条样式和颜色。
- 最后,点击“确定”按钮以应用横线到日期之间。
2. 为什么我在Excel中添加了横线,但是日期之间没有显示横线?
如果您在Excel中添加了横线,但日期之间没有显示横线,可能有以下几个原因:
- 首先,请确保您选择了正确的单元格,并在正确的单元格上应用了边框。
- 其次,请检查日期格式是否正确。有时候,如果日期格式不正确,边框可能不会显示。尝试选择合适的日期格式并重新应用边框。
- 最后,请确保您选择的线条样式和颜色与背景颜色不冲突。如果线条颜色与背景颜色相同,横线可能会不可见。
3. 我如何在Excel中自定义日期之间的横线样式?
在Excel中,您可以按照以下步骤自定义日期之间的横线样式:
- 首先,选中包含日期的单元格,然后点击“开始”选项卡上的“边框”按钮。
- 在弹出的边框格式对话框中,选择“底部边框”选项。
- 然后,在线条样式和颜色下拉菜单中,选择您想要的线条样式和颜色。您还可以点击“更多边框”按钮,以获得更多自定义选项。
- 最后,点击“确定”按钮以应用自定义的横线样式到日期之间。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4612322